Exchange gas prices in Europe fall by 4.4%
Energy
- 13 February, 2023
- 08:14
Gas prices in Europe fell by over 4% at the beginning of the first trading day of the week, Report informs with reference to the London Stock Exchange ICE.
March (nearest) futures on the TTF index (the largest hub in Europe, located in the Netherlands) opened trading at $573.9 per thousand cubic meters. Then they fell to $570.4 (-4.4%).
The dynamics of quotations are based on the settlement price of the previous trading day (Friday) - $596.7 per thousand cubic meters.
